Veturi Sundarrama Murthy



Veturi Sundararama Murthy Garu..



My idol.The stalwart who spurred the thought in me, to pen my inner feelings, in the form of songs..


For a long time[pre-2006], the name "Veturi" was just a 6-letter word V-E-T-U-R-I.
Little did i know that he can influence my life in such big way..
Little did i know that there is a poet in me..
Little did i know that music will be more dearer to me..
Little did i know that i will cry for him one day..
and Little did i know that he will leave such a big void in my life......

It was 2006, when my favv actor Raja's movie MAYABAZAAR had its audio released.
Moreover the music was by the-then famous MD - KM Radhakrishnan.
Me being a big time music zealot, wasted no time in downloading the mp3s of the album.
Soon i was in trance listening to one of the most enchanting melodies. The songs " Preme Neramouna Brovabhaarama" and "Sarojadhalanetri" had just left a big impact on me.
The lyrics were truly mesmerising and the bliss was cascaded by curiousity to know the lyricist of these songs.It was V-E-T-U-R-I!!
The thought-process-line in me had shifted by 180 degrees and suddenly the six letter word seemed more meaningful and complete.
This was the trigger point, that made me take up, the art of pouring our feelings [transformed into words] onto the white sheet. And suddenly the white sheet seemed colourful. :)

I started to write small 4-line poems.. Or max 6-7 lines.. and this went on for many days.. Slowly but surely my writing skills went on improving.. These days i am in a position to pen complete songs.. The true inspiration behind all these is certainly Veturi garu.. Everytime any new music album releases, the first thing i do is to check if my idol has penned any songs in that album.. It feels so pathetic now to learn that all new music albums will no more have his name embedded on the CD......

From 2006, i have googled a lot and digged out all his songs starting from 1970 till date.. i observed that all major hits were penned by the prodigy himself.. To name a few.. Shankarabharanam, Geetanjali, Anand, Godavari, Maatrudevobhava, Happydays Title Track, Annamayya, Gangotri, Sri Ramadasu,Roja etc etc....... the list goes on...........

Music got its complete meaning with Veturi.. A person with 8 Nandi Awards needs no explanation.

With my humble salutation, i sincerely pray that he lives in all our hearts forever.......
